view与layer都可以进行显示内容的控制。这两者负责的功能是由区别的。view即显示的地图容器,有以下几个属性:center:[经度,纬度] ,对应的设置函数为view.setCenter()。。用于设置一个地图上的点,该点将显示在view中央。zoom:放缩等级,对应的设置函数为view.setZoom()。一个地图可以有多个放缩等级,为view设置zoom,则会将地图放缩到对应的等级。通常
文章目录1.简介2.属性(1)filter 可实现过滤(2)layers 也可实现过滤(3)features 存放被选择的图层的集合(4)condition 设置选择方式,默认sigleClick(5)addCondition 配合removeCondition可实现使用不同的方法进行添加删除(6)removeCondition 配合addCondition可实现使用不同的方法进行添加删除(7)
转载 2024-08-19 19:41:36
384阅读
开始使用vue-resource导入bootstrap也可以这样导入,这个是最新的版本点击这两个删除的区别,一个会重新刷新网页删除 删除全局配置地址如果配置了请求的数据接口根域名,在每次单独发起http的时候,也因该是相对路径开头,不能带斜线,否则不会启用根路径拼接{emulateJSON:true}以普通表单格式,将数据提交给服务器 application/x-www-form-urlencod
上篇文章讲到 ,初始化map地图,必备的三要素之一就是视图(view),这个对象主要是控制地图与人的交互,如进行缩放,调节分辨率、地图的旋转等控制。也就是说每个 map对象包含一个 view对象部分,用于控制与用户的交互。1. view 属性center模组:ol / coordinate〜Coordinate视图的初始中心。如果未设置用户投影,则使用projection选项指定中心的坐标系。如果
转载 2024-05-20 20:43:37
310阅读
//新建点线面图层 addDrawLayer() { this.draw_vector = new VectorLayer({ source: this.draw_source, title: '自由图层绘制点线面', name: 'operateTu',
what is openlayer openlayers是一个高性能、功能全面的地图库。有以下特性:支持各种格式的tiled layers数据使用canvas的高性能vector layer细粒度丰富的交互操作支持commanjs风格开源免费 why use it 一般来说google map api就满足需求了,但是当需要在地图上绘制大量节点时,使用svg来显示部件就会出现很严重的性能问题,一
转载 2024-07-02 19:51:16
216阅读
openLayers点击事件 interactioninteraction是一个虚基类,不负责实例化,交互功能都继承该基类, 功能如下:doubleclickzoom interaction,双击放大交互功能;draganddrop interaction,以“拖文件到地图中”的交互添加图层;dragbox interaction,拉框,用于划定一个矩形范围,常用于放大地图;dragpan int
转载 2024-07-31 18:28:40
314阅读
目录一、WMTS简介二、WMTS的接口2.1、GetCapabilities2.2、GetTile2.3、GetFeatureInfo三、加载ArcGIS产品发布的WMTS服务数据3.1、加载ArcGIS Online发布的WMTS服务数据 3.2、加载ArcGIS Server发布的WMTS服务数据四、加载GeoServer发布的WMTS服务数据五、加载天地图的WMTS服务数据六、总结
转载 2024-05-02 20:39:43
76阅读
OpenLayers学习笔记初级篇创建一个简单的地图new ol.Map({ // 设置地图图层 layers: [ // 创建一个使用Open Street Map地图源的瓦片图层 new ol.layer.Tile({source: new ol.source.OSM()}) ], // 设置显示地图的视图 view: n
转载 5月前
62阅读
 OpenLayers项目分析——(九)控件(九)OpenLayers中的控件   OpenLayers中的控件,是通过加载到地图上而起作用的,也算地图表现的一部分。同时,控件需要对地图发生作用,所以每个控件也持有对地图(map对象)的引用。   前面说过,控件是于事件相关联的。具体的说就是控件的实现是依赖于事件绑定的,每个OpenLayers.Control及其子类
转载 10月前
129阅读
1、前言为了提升人机交互的体验,OpenLayers提供了一系列的地图动画效果如下所示:// 第一步:获取当前视图va
原创 2023-07-18 14:46:34
1050阅读
OpenLayers项目分析——(十)事件机制分析(十)OpenLayers事件机制分析   OpenLayers中的事件封装是其一大亮点,非常值得学习。说到事件机制,在宏观上不得不涉及控件OpenLayers.Control类、OpenLayers. Marker类、OpenLayers.Icon类等。是这样,在外观上控件通过Marker和Icon表现出来,而事件包含在控件之后,用他们
转载 2024-02-23 07:10:38
336阅读
数据加载原理GIS地图加载的一般原理在web端加载切片地图和矢量地图的原理基本相同(1)瓦片地图。在web端加载瓦片地图一般有两种方式。一种为直接读取缓存加载,也就是说直接读取硬盘中存储的瓦片图片,另一种为调用瓦片地图接口,例如Arcgis Server、GeoServer等.。加载原理:通过Ajax请求瓦片地图服务或数据,根据瓦片地图的级数、行列号分别获取对应的瓦片地图,将其按照请求的控件范围组
转载 9月前
107阅读
openlayers官网地址:OpenLayers - Welcome1. 自己学习openlayers 的背景最近公司项目需要使用到GIS地图为依托做一些交互(如点 聚合分散,热力图,地图下钻,图层叠加,点位图,地图轨迹,地图图层切换)等功能,于是我临危受命不得不去学习openlayers。2. 现在聊聊 openlayers 是什么?发展历程?优势?怎么使用?2.1 openlaye
转载 7月前
55阅读
OpenLayers 百万点位撒点 文章目录OpenLayers 百万点位撒点一、解决方案二、使用步骤1.引入库2.html代码3.js代码 提示:下面案例可供参考一、解决方案设置网格,把地图切分成不同网格,在zoon 视图放大到一定程度,进行视图大小获取点位撒点二、使用步骤1.引入库代码如下(示例):import 'ol/ol.css' import { Map, View } from 'ol
转载 2024-02-21 13:51:53
54阅读
step1. 在geoserver中发布wmts图层首先需要在指定的工作区中勾上wmtsstep2. geoserver中添加数据存储我这里是发布的多个tif,所以我选择ImageMosaic类型,弄好之后点击发布,配置好自己的发布参数,点击发布。 发布完成之后可以在图层中预览,但是现在的图层是以wms方式来预览的setp3. 切片处理 点击tile Layers项,选择要切片的图层之前,可以切换
转载 2024-02-27 21:31:43
198阅读
openlayers 遮罩效果openlayers 行政区突出遮罩效果
原创 2023-11-02 10:11:11
519阅读
<!DOCTYPE html>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title>overla
转载 2021-07-06 14:26:15
610阅读
Overlay 从名字看,是覆盖图、覆盖物的意思,主要的用途就是在地图之上再覆盖一层,用以显示额外的可见元素,可见元素一般是 HTML 元素,利用 overlay,可以将可见元素放置到地图的任意位置,形成地图上再浮动一层的效果。例如在地图上相应的坐标放置一个标志,标签,利用 overlay ...
转载 2017-04-26 10:54:00
229阅读
2评论
openlayers浅入(了解框架逻辑以及简单使用)项目需求,使用openlayers替换天地图api开发,记录openlayer的使用简介OpenLayers是一个用于开发WebGIS客户端的JavaScript包,最初基于BSD许可发行。OpenLayers是一个开源的项目,其设计之意是为互联网客户端提供强大的地图展示功能,包括地图数据显示与相关操作,并具有灵活的扩展机制。目前OpenLaye
  • 1
  • 2
  • 3
  • 4
  • 5